英 [ˈbrʌʃ ɒf]
搪塞:指对某人或某事不予理睬或不予重视。
摆脱:指迅速摆脱或拒绝某人或某事。
轻拂:指轻轻地拂去灰尘、污垢等。
brush off // [ brushing brushed brushes ]
动词词组 If someone brushes you off when you speak to them, they refuse to talk to you or be nice to you. 不予理睬; 冷落
When I tried to talk to her about it she just brushed me off.
我试图与她谈谈那件事,她就是不理我。
→see alsobrush-off
a curt or disdainful rejection
同义词: brush-off
bar from attention or consideration
同义词: dismiss / disregard / brush aside / discount / push aside / ignore
